Using traditional foundry techniques we manufacture our cast metal baths in iron and aluminium. Cast iron has long been the favoured metal used for traditional baths but as processes evolve we now offer cast aluminium as a lighter alternative. At 40% of the mass of iron, aluminium is an equally durable and hard-wearing base metal. Each piece from our metal bath collection is made to order at our local Kentish foundry.
